Observatory Hill Park Off Leash Area


Overview
Located in Sydney’s Inner City, Observatory Hill Park in Millers Point provides an off-leash space with some of the best views in the city.
The park is unfenced and set on elevated ground overlooking the Sydney Harbour Bridge and CBD skyline. Its unique setting and open grassy areas make it a memorable spot for dog owners who want more than just a local park.
The off-leash area is spacious and open, with rolling lawns, shady trees, and seating for owners. Its hilltop position creates a scenic, breezy atmosphere, and the open layout gives dogs plenty of room to run while owners enjoy the views.
Because the space is unfenced and sits close to surrounding roads, strong recall is essential. The grassed surface is generally well maintained, though it can become slippery or muddy after rain. There are no dog-specific facilities, so owners should bring their own water.
The park is within walking distance of The Rocks, Walsh Bay, and Barangaroo, giving owners easy access to cafés, pubs, and harbourfront walks. Its location makes it one of the most iconic spots for a dog outing in Sydney.
Observatory Hill Park is best suited to confident and energetic dogs who enjoy wide open runs and busy environments.
Observatory Hill Park is managed by the City of Sydney Council.
